Regulatory Framework and Compliance

The Italian gambling market is governed by the Agenzia delle Dogane e dei Monopoli (ADM), the regulatory body responsible for licensing and overseeing all forms of gambling, including online casinos. The ADM’s framework is designed to protect consumers, prevent money laundering, and ensure fair play. Strict licensing requirements, including financial stability and operational expertise, are in place to ensure that only reputable operators can enter the market. Compliance with ADM regulations is non-negotiable, and failure to adhere to these rules can result in significant penalties, including license revocation. The ADM actively monitors operators’ activities, conducting regular audits and investigations to ensure compliance. This includes scrutinizing game fairness, payment processing, and responsible gambling measures. Operators must implement robust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ures to verify player identities and prevent underage gambling. Furthermore, they are required to implement measures to detect and prevent money laundering, adhering to strict anti-money laundering (AML) protocols. The ADM also sets standards for responsible gambling, mandating that operators provide t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its. This includes de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support services. The regulatory environment in Italy is constantly evolving, with the ADM regularly updating its regulations to address emerging challenges and technological advancements. Operators must stay abreast of these changes and adapt their operations accordingly. This includes incorporating new technologies, such as artificial intelligence, to enhance player protection and improve the overall gaming experience. The ADM’s commitment to responsible gambling and player protection has helped to foster a more sustainable and ethical gambling market in Italy. The stringent regulatory environment, while demanding, ultimately benefits both consumers and operators by promoting trust and transparency.
